1. A Smoother, Stronger Flooring Surface
Liquid screed — also known as flowing screed or anhydrite screed — is engineered specifically to deliver a perfectly smooth, level surface. Unlike traditional cement screeds that require manual raking, levelling, and trowelling, liquid screed simply flows across the floor, settling naturally into every space.
🔧 Why the smoothness matters:
-
Ideal for modern flooring such as LVT, large tiles, engineered wood, and laminate
-
Reduces labour costs thanks to minimal manual finishing
-
Provides better structural integrity, leaving fewer weak spots or air pockets
-
Minimises floor preparation required for final coverings
A flatter surface means fewer issues later — no creaking boards, no tile rocking, and no extra levelling compounds needed.

2. The Perfect Partner for Underfloor Heating (UFH)
If your home renovation includes underfloor heating, liquid screed is hands-down the best option.
Because of its fluid consistency, liquid screed fully encapsulates your heating pipes, creating excellent thermal contact. This allows heat to travel more efficiently through the floor surface, warming your home faster — and using less energy.
🔥 Benefits for UK homeowners:
-
Improved heat transfer and efficiency
-
Even temperatures across the entire room
-
Reduced heating bills over time
-
Extended UFH system lifespan due to proper coverage

3. Faster Installation & Quicker Drying Times
One of the biggest frustrations during a renovation is waiting — waiting for plaster to dry, waiting for paint to cure, and waiting for screed to set. Traditional sand-and-cement screed can take weeks before it’s ready for flooring.
Liquid screed changes that completely.
⏱ Typical liquid screed timeline:
-
Walkable within 24–48 hours
-
UFH commissioning can usually begin after 7 days
-
Final flooring can be added significantly sooner than with traditional screed (subject to moisture testing)

4. Eco-Friendly, Efficient & Future-Proof
Sustainability is becoming more important across the UK construction industry, and liquid screed ticks many eco-friendly boxes.
Many modern liquid screeds are:
-
Made with recycled materials
-
Require less water
-
Produce less waste
-
Offer long lifespan and durability
Plus, because liquid screed works so well with low-temperature heating systems, it complements modern energy-efficient homes and the UK’s push toward reducing carbon emissions.
For homeowners looking to future-proof their property, liquid screed fits perfectly with energy-efficient insulation, air-source heat pumps, and well-designed UFH systems.
